The Rubik’s Cube, a timeless 3D puzzle, has captivated minds for decades with its vibrant colors and mechanical ingenuity. While solving the cube is a common challenge, designing one from scratch offers a unique opportunity to explore the intersection of geometry, engineering, and 3D modeling. With the rise of user-friendly 3D design tools like SelfCAD, creating a digital version of the Rubik’s Cube has become more accessible than ever. This article will guide readers through the step-by-step process of designing a fully functional Rubik’s Cube using SelfCAD, demonstrating how modern technology can be used to recreate a classic object through creative and technical skill.
